Output e37818a79b7a60514aaea64927427d5edc1c88da92a94569fb88398d5a04c16e:1

value
6071350
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ab4ce9d46f79cb253510677a08726ca266dc0320719527c928db5aea4f38e66
address
tb1p326va82x77wty563qem6ppexegnxmspjquv4ylyj3k66af8n3enqz2w9ec
transaction
e37818a79b7a60514aaea64927427d5edc1c88da92a94569fb88398d5a04c16e
confirmations
26799
spent
true